10 words from this day's editorials

  • Vivid (adjective)Producing powerful feelings or strong, clear images in the mind, or a very bright colour.सजीव, सुस्पष्ट, चटकीला Synonyms: Evocative, Realistic, Lively, Lucid Flamboyant · Antonyms: Vague, Boring, Dull, Murky
  • Malignant (adjective)Causing an extremely serious, possibly even fatal, issue.घातक, हानिकारक Synonyms: Malicious, Cancerous, Malevolent, Vicious, Virulent · Antonyms: Benign, Harmless, Friendly, Tender
  • Plummet (verb)Fall or drop straight down at high speed.तेज़ी से गिरना Synonyms: Plunge, Fall, Drop, Dive, Crash · Antonyms: Rise, Ascend, Soar, Escalate, Increase
  • Run amok (idiom)They behave in a violent and uncontrolled way.हिसात्मक आचरण Synonyms: Go Berserk, Rampage, Run Riot, Frenzy · Antonyms: Calm, Peace, Tranquillity, Stillness
  • Botched (adjective)Used to describe something, usually a job, that is done badly:ढिलाई से काम करना Synonyms: Bungled, Awkward, Mishandled, Maladroit, Spoiled · Antonyms: Adroit, Deft, Dexterous, Facile
  • Bluster (noun)Boastful speech or writing.शेखी, डींग Synonyms: Boast, Brag, Swagger, Bombast, Grandiloquence · Antonyms: Modest, Humility, Humbleness
  • Fiendish (adjective)Extremely cruel or unpleasant.पैशाचिक, राक्षस-सा Synonyms: Diabolical, Devilish, Satanic, Demonic, Evil · Antonyms: Angelic, Humane, Kind, Compassionate, Sympathetic
  • Innuendo (noun)Indirect reference to something rude or unpleasant.इशारा, संकेत Synonyms: Insinuation, Hint, Allusion, Suggestion, Reference · Antonyms: Evidence, Proof, Statement
  • Pesky (adjective)Annoying or causing trouble.परेशान करनेवाला या सतानेवाला Synonyms: Vexing, Irksome, Irritating, Pestiferous, Exasperating · Antonyms: Pleasing, Delightful, Untroubling
  • Play second fiddle (idiom)Have a subordinate role to someone or something.अधीनस्थ, कम, या छोटी भूमिका निभाना Synonyms: Follow, Servitude, Subjugation, Trail · Antonyms: Rule, Lead, Guide, Precede
